Polynomial Besselian Elements for:   2832 Apr 22    1.000 TDT  (=t0)

  n        x          y         d          l1         l2          μ

  0  -0.4619270  1.2268651 12.3792200  0.5471890  0.0010460 195.323715 
  1   0.5357216  0.1372902  0.0136300 -0.0001143 -0.0001137  15.002970 
  2   0.0000586 -0.0001317 -0.0000030 -0.0000116 -0.0000116   0.000000 
  3  -0.0000078 -0.0000019  0.0000000  0.0000000  0.0000000   0.000000
  
                tan f1 = 0.0046696        tan f2 = 0.0046463 

At time t1 (decimal hours), each Besselian element is evaluated by:

a = a0 + a1*t + a2*t2 + a3*t3  

where: a = x, y, d, l1, l2, or μ; t = t1 - t0 (decimal hours), and t0 =   1.000 TDT.
